Keno is one of those games you either know about or you do not. It’s typically considered a lottery in the casino. Like the lotto, the game consists of numbered balls being drawn. The object is to pick the numbers that will be selected. The game of Keno can be either quick or slow depending on the casino. By wagering on Keno on the net you can control the speed of the game. Keno Board
The game is gambled on on a board. The Keno board is made up of eighty numbers total – number 1 to 80. The 1st forty are known as a the top half and the bottom forty are known as the bottom half.
Competing in Keno
Each game of Keno goes in the same manner. The game commences, and 20 numbers are selected. The casino may be using the ball system. Ping pong style balls are blown up and chosen, just like the lotto on television. Other casinos utilize pc’s. If a number you picked is chosen, that is called a "hit." When all 20 numbers have been picked, the game finishes and winning tickets are cashed-in.
There is a lot of options in the game of Keno. For instance, you might choose a single number, two numbers and so on up to 20 numbers. Normally, you need to get most of your numbers to come away with anything. For instance, if you select 6 numbers, you will generally have to hit 3 to win your money back.
Keno Pay outs
The pay outs in Keno are pretty big. The chances of coming away with a win will be dependent on the total numbers picked. For instance, if you pick two numbers, you will have a 6% chance of hitting your ticket. Each casino has their very own pay outs.
